Site2Host

Linux Server vs Windows Server: Key Differences 2026

Linux Server vs Windows Server: Key Differences 2026

Choosing a server operating system is one of the most important infrastructure decisions you will make for your business. Get it right, and your applications run smoothly, your team works efficiently, and your costs stay under control. Get it wrong, and you spend months dealing with compatibility headaches, security gaps, and unexpected expenses.

The debate between Linux servers and Windows servers has been going on for decades, and in 2026, both platforms have matured significantly. Each has a loyal user base and solid reasons to be chosen. But they are not interchangeable, and the best choice depends entirely on what you are building, who manages it, and what your long-term goals are.

This guide will cut through the noise and give you a clear, honest comparison so you can make the right call.

What Is a Linux Server?

Linux Server is an open-source operating system built on the Linux kernel. It powers a massive portion of the internet, from small personal projects to enterprise-scale applications at companies like Google, Amazon, and Meta.

Because Linux is open source, there is no licensing fee for most distributions. Popular server distributions include Ubuntu Server, CentOS, Debian, AlmaLinux, and Rocky Linux. Each is maintained by a community or an organization, and each has slightly different strengths.

Linux servers are managed primarily through a command-line interface, though graphical management panels like cPanel are widely available for web hosting environments. The ecosystem is rich, the community support is extensive, and the performance on standard hardware tends to be strong.

What Is Windows Server?

Windows Server is a proprietary operating system developed by Microsoft. It is designed to integrate tightly with other Microsoft products, including Active Directory, Microsoft SQL Server, Exchange Server, SharePoint, and the Microsoft 365 suite.

Unlike Linux, Windows Server requires a paid license, and the cost can be significant depending on the version and the number of users or cores. However, for organizations already invested in the Microsoft ecosystem, Windows Server often reduces complexity because everything speaks the same language.

Windows Server offers a familiar graphical interface, which lowers the barrier to entry for teams that are not comfortable with command-line management.

Linux Server vs Windows Server: Head-to-Head Comparison

Cost

Linux Server wins here by a clear margin. Most Linux distributions are free to use, meaning your primary costs are hardware, infrastructure, and support if needed. Windows Server, on the other hand, requires purchasing a license from Microsoft. Depending on the edition and the number of virtual machines or cores you need to cover, licensing costs can run into thousands of dollars annually.

For startups and small businesses watching their budget, this alone can be a decisive factor.

Performance

Linux is known for efficient resource utilization. It can run effectively on older or lower-specification hardware and handles high-traffic workloads with less overhead. This is a major reason why web servers, database servers, and cloud infrastructure overwhelmingly run on Linux.

Windows Server performs well in environments where Microsoft applications are central, but it generally requires more RAM and processing power for the same workload compared to a lean Linux setup.

Security

Both operating systems take security seriously, but they approach it differently. Linux benefits from its open-source nature, where vulnerabilities are identified and patched quickly by a global community. It also has a smaller attack surface in terms of targeted malware, partly because of how permissions and user privileges work at the system level.

Windows Server is a more common target for cyberattacks given its widespread use in corporate environments. Microsoft has invested heavily in security features over the years, including Windows Defender, BitLocker, and robust Group Policy controls, but it still requires diligent patching and management.

Ease of Use

Windows Server is more approachable for teams already familiar with the Windows environment. The graphical interface makes common administrative tasks accessible without deep technical knowledge.

Linux has a steeper learning curve for those unfamiliar with command-line interfaces, but the trade-off is greater control and flexibility. Once your team is comfortable, Linux administration is fast and efficient.

Application and Software Compatibility

This is where Windows Server has a significant advantage for certain organizations. If your business relies on Microsoft-specific software, such as ASP.NET applications, SQL Server, SharePoint, or Microsoft Exchange, Windows Server is the natural environment.

Linux excels with open-source stacks. LAMP (Linux, Apache, MySQL, PHP) and LEMP (Linux, Nginx, MySQL, PHP) configurations power the majority of websites and web applications globally. If your stack is PHP, Python, Node.js, Ruby, or Java-based, Linux is an excellent and well-supported choice.

Stability and Uptime

Linux servers are famous for their uptime. Many Linux systems run continuously for years without needing a restart. Updates can often be applied without rebooting, which is a significant advantage in environments where downtime is costly.

Windows Server typically requires restarts after major updates and patches, which demands planned maintenance windows.

Support

Windows Server comes with Microsoft’s official support ecosystem, which is a comfort factor for enterprises with support contracts in place.

Linux support depends on the distribution and whether you are using a community version or a commercially supported one such as Red Hat Enterprise Linux or Ubuntu Pro. For web hosting environments, most hosting providers offer strong support for Linux-based servers.

When to Choose Linux Server

Linux is the right choice when you are running web applications, databases, or cloud workloads on open-source technology stacks. It is also ideal when cost efficiency matters, when you have a technically capable team comfortable with command-line management, or when you need maximum control over your server environment.

If you are hosting WordPress, Magento, Laravel, Django, or similar platforms, Linux is almost always the better-performing and more cost-effective option.

When to Choose Windows Server

Windows Server makes sense when your business depends on Microsoft-native applications. If you run .NET applications, use Microsoft SQL Server as your database, or need seamless integration with Active Directory and Microsoft 365, Windows Server will save you integration headaches and is the more practical choice.

It is also worth considering Windows Server if your IT team has deep Windows expertise and limited Linux experience, as the total cost of retraining and managing an unfamiliar platform can outweigh the licensing savings.

A Quick Reference: Linux vs Windows Server at a Glance

Feature

Linux Server

Windows Server

Cost

Free (most distros)

Paid license required

Performance

High and low overhead

Good, higher resource use

Security

Strong, smaller attack surface

Robust but more targeted

Ease of Use

Command-line focused

GUI-friendly

Best For

Web hosting, open-source apps

Microsoft ecosystem, .NET apps

Uptime

Excellent, minimal restarts

Good, requires planned downtime

How Site2Host Helps You Get This Right

Picking the right server OS is only half the equation. The other half is choosing a hosting partner that understands your needs, configures your environment correctly, and supports you when things get complex.

At Site2Host, we offer both Linux VPS and Windows VPS hosting with NVMe-powered storage, full root access, dedicated IP addresses, and scalable plans built for real business demands. Whether you are starting fresh with a new application or migrating an existing server setup, our team has the experience to guide you through every step.

Your Next Step Forward

The choice between Linux Server and Windows Server ultimately comes down to your software environment, your team’s expertise, and your budget. Linux delivers outstanding performance and cost efficiency for web-focused workloads. Windows Server provides seamless compatibility for Microsoft-dependent applications.

Both are powerful. Neither is universally better. The right one is the one that fits your actual needs.

With proven results across hundreds of businesses, industry expertise in both Linux and Windows environments, and round-the-clock technical support, Site2Host consistently delivers outcomes that competitors can’t match. If you want reliable, fast, and expertly managed server hosting, reach out to us today and let’s find the right solution together.

With proven results, industry expertise, and reliable support, we consistently deliver outcomes that competitors cannot match. If you want an infrastructure that grows with your ambitions and never lets your visitors down, get in touch with Site2Host today. 📞 +91-88988 16336 | +91-97681 14582 📧 [email protected] 🌍 www.site2host.com
Facebook
Twitter
LinkedIn
Email